What is a Tall Unit in the Kitchen?

A tall unit, also known as a pantry unit, is a vertical storage cabinet that is typically floor-to-ceiling in height. It is designed to provide ample storage space for your kitchen essentials, such as groceries, cookware, and small appliances. A tall unit is a practical and efficient way to organize and declutter your kitchen.

Types of Tall Units in a Modular Kitchen

When it comes to tall units in modular kitchens, there are several options to choose from:

1. Pull-Out Tall Unit

A pull-out tall unit features shelves that can be pulled out for easy access to items stored at the back. This type of tall unit is ideal for storing canned goods, jars, and other pantry staples.

2. Swing-Out Tall Unit

A swing-out tall unit consists of shelves that swing out when the cabinet door is opened. This design allows for better visibility and accessibility to items stored inside.

3. Corner Tall Unit

A corner tall unit is specifically designed to make use of the often underutilized corner space in your kitchen. It maximizes storage capacity while optimizing the use of available space.

Tall Unit in Kitchen Price

The price of a tall unit in the kitchen can vary depending on various factors such as the material used, size, design, and brand. On average, you can expect to spend between $500 and $2000 for a high-quality tall unit. It is important to consider your budget and requirements when choosing the right tall unit for your kitchen.

Tall Unit in Kitchen Size

When determining the size of the tall unit for your kitchen, it is crucial to consider the available space and your storage needs. Measure the height, width, and depth of the area where you plan to install the tall unit. Keep in mind that the standard height for a tall unit is around 2000mm to 2400mm, but it can be customized to fit your specific requirements.

Additionally, consider the internal storage space of the tall unit. Opt for adjustable shelves to accommodate items of different sizes. It is also helpful to have a mix of open shelves and closed cabinets to cater to various storage needs.
